深入解析易语言时间源码:探索编程之美 文章
在编程的世界里,时间是一个不可或缺的元素。无论是记录日志、处理业务逻辑还是进行数据分析,时间函数都扮演着至关重要的角色。易语言,作为一款易学易用的编程语言,其时间源码更是深受广大编程爱好者的喜爱。本文将深入解析易语言时间源码,带领读者领略编程之美。
一、易语言简介
易语言,全称易语言编程环境,是一款由我国自主研发的编程语言。它具有语法简单、易于上手、跨平台等特点,适用于初学者和有一定编程基础的开发者。易语言支持多种编程范式,包括面向过程、面向对象和函数式编程,为用户提供了丰富的编程选择。
二、易语言时间源码概述
易语言的时间源码主要涉及以下几个函数:
1.Now()
:获取当前系统时间,返回一个字符串,格式为“年-月-日 时:分:秒”。
2.Date()
:获取当前系统日期,返回一个字符串,格式为“年-月-日”。
3.Time()
:获取当前系统时间,返回一个字符串,格式为“时:分:秒”。
4.Today()
:获取当前系统日期,返回一个字符串,格式为“年-月-日”。
5.NowMilli()
:获取当前系统时间的毫秒值,返回一个整数。
6.DateDiff()
:计算两个日期之间的差值,返回一个整数,单位为天。
7.TimeDiff()
:计算两个时间之间的差值,返回一个整数,单位为秒。
8.DateAdd()
:在指定日期上增加或减少天数,返回一个新的日期字符串。
9.TimeAdd()
:在指定时间上增加或减少秒数,返回一个新的时间字符串。
三、易语言时间源码应用实例
以下是一些使用易语言时间源码的实例,帮助读者更好地理解其应用:
1.记录日志
易语言
Dim NowTime As String
NowTime = Now()
Print "当前时间:" & NowTime
2.计算两个日期之间的天数差
`易语言
Dim Date1 As String
Dim Date2 As String
Dim DateDiff As Integer
Date1 = "2021-01-01"
Date2 = "2021-01-10"
DateDiff = DateDiff(Date1, Date2)
Print "两个日期之间的天数差为:" & DateDiff
`
3.计算两个时间之间的秒数差
`易语言
Dim Time1 As String
Dim Time2 As String
Dim TimeDiff As Integer
Time1 = "08:00:00"
Time2 = "12:00:00"
TimeDiff = TimeDiff(Time1, Time2)
Print "两个时间之间的秒数差为:" & TimeDiff
`
四、总结
易语言时间源码为开发者提供了丰富的功能,使得处理时间相关的问题变得简单快捷。通过本文的解析,相信读者对易语言时间源码有了更深入的了解。在今后的编程实践中,熟练运用这些时间函数,将有助于提升编程效率,解决更多实际问题。让我们一起探索编程之美,共同进步!